Pros

Competitive pay and quick promotions. The owner has a good heart and wants his company and customers to succeed.

Cons

Too many bulls in the management pen causing confusion, drama, and inability to maintain proper procedures and structure within the company. Not enough work/life balance, extreme superstar expectations without gratitude. Has potential to have long term employees but can't quite grasp what needs to be done to keep them. The owner cares about his company but has too many people in his ear and sometimes trusts the wrong people who have their own agenda, especially shiny new employees who talk without the walk, leaving previously trusted employees no choice but to leave. The micromanagement is typically from department managers in sales and parts. Department managers lack accountability and engage in a lot of shaming and blaming.
